| accept(BaseVisitor *v) | OpenMD::Atom | virtual | 
  | accept(BaseVisitor *v) | OpenMD::Atom | virtual | 
  | addDensity(RealType dens) | OpenMD::StuntDouble | inline | 
  | addDensity(RealType dens,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addElectricField(const Vector3d &eField) | OpenMD::StuntDouble | inline | 
  | addElectricField(const Vector3d &eField,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addFlucQFrc(RealType cfrc) | OpenMD::StuntDouble | inline | 
  | addFlucQFrc(RealType cfrc,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addFlucQPos(RealType charge) | OpenMD::StuntDouble | inline | 
  | addFlucQPos(RealType charge,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addFlucQVel(RealType cvel) | OpenMD::StuntDouble | inline | 
  | addFlucQVel(RealType cvel,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addFrc(const Vector3d &frc) | OpenMD::StuntDouble | inline | 
  | addFrc(const Vector3d &frc,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addParticlePot(const RealType &particlePot) | OpenMD::StuntDouble | inline | 
  | addParticlePot(const RealType &particlePot,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addPrevDensity(RealType dens) | OpenMD::StuntDouble | inline | 
  | addPrevElectricField(const Vector3d &eField) | OpenMD::StuntDouble | inline | 
  | addPrevFlucQFrc(RealType cfrc) | OpenMD::StuntDouble | inline | 
  | addPrevFlucQPos(RealType charge) | OpenMD::StuntDouble | inline | 
  | addPrevFlucQVel(RealType cvel) | OpenMD::StuntDouble | inline | 
  | addPrevFrc(const Vector3d &frc) | OpenMD::StuntDouble | inline | 
  | addPrevParticlePot(const RealType &particlePot) | OpenMD::StuntDouble | inline | 
  | addPrevSitePotential(RealType spot) | OpenMD::StuntDouble | inline | 
  | addPrevTrq(const Vector3d &trq) | OpenMD::StuntDouble | inline | 
  | addProperty(std::shared_ptr< GenericData > genData) | OpenMD::StuntDouble |  | 
  | addSitePotential(RealType spot) | OpenMD::StuntDouble | inline | 
  | addSitePotential(RealType spot,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| addTrq(const Vector3d &trq) | OpenMD::StuntDouble | inline | 
  | addTrq(const Vector3d &trq,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| Atom(AtomType *at) (defined in OpenMD::Atom) | OpenMD::Atom |  | 
  | Atom(AtomType *at) (defined in OpenMD::Atom) | OpenMD::Atom |  | 
  | atomType_ (defined in OpenMD::Atom) | OpenMD::Atom | protected | 
  | body2Lab(const Vector3d &v) | OpenMD::StuntDouble | inline | 
  | body2Lab(const Vector3d &v, int frame)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| inline | 
  | chargeMass_ (defined in OpenMD::Atom) | OpenMD::Atom | protected | 
  | combineForcesAndTorques(Snapshot *snapA, Snapshot *snapB, RealType multA, RealType multB) | OpenMD::StuntDouble |  | 
  | freeze() | OpenMD::StuntDouble | inline | 
  | getA() | OpenMD::StuntDouble | inline | 
  | getA(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getAtomType() | OpenMD::Atom | inline | 
  | getAtomType() | OpenMD::Atom | inline | 
  | getChargeMass()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| getChargeMass()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| getCOM() | OpenMD::StuntDouble | inline | 
  | getCOM(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getCOMvel() | OpenMD::StuntDouble | inline | 
  | getCOMvel(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getCOMw() | OpenMD::StuntDouble | inline | 
  | getCOMw(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getDensity() | OpenMD::StuntDouble | inline | 
  | getDensity(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getDipole() | OpenMD::StuntDouble | inline | 
  | getDipole(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getElectricField() | OpenMD::StuntDouble | inline | 
  | getElectricField(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getEuler() | OpenMD::StuntDouble | inline | 
  | getEuler(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getFlucQFrc() | OpenMD::StuntDouble | inline | 
  | getFlucQFrc(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getFlucQPos() | OpenMD::StuntDouble | inline | 
  | getFlucQPos(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getFlucQVel() | OpenMD::StuntDouble | inline | 
  | getFlucQVel(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getFrc() | OpenMD::StuntDouble | inline | 
  | getFrc(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getGlobalIndex() | OpenMD::StuntDouble | inline | 
  | getGlobalIntegrableObjectIndex() (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| inline | 
  | getGrad() | OpenMD::Atom | virtual | 
  | getGrad() | OpenMD::Atom | virtual | 
  | getHybridization() const | OpenMD::Atom | inline | 
  | getI() | OpenMD::Atom | virtual | 
  | getI() | OpenMD::Atom | virtual | 
  | getIdent()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| getIdent()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| getJ() | OpenMD::StuntDouble | inline | 
  | getJ(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getLocalIndex() | OpenMD::StuntDouble | inline | 
  | getMass() | OpenMD::StuntDouble | inline | 
  | getParticlePot() | OpenMD::StuntDouble | inline | 
  | getParticlePot(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getPos() | OpenMD::StuntDouble | inline | 
  | getPos(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getPrevA() | OpenMD::StuntDouble | inline | 
  | getPrevDensity() | OpenMD::StuntDouble | inline | 
  | getPrevDipole() | OpenMD::StuntDouble | inline | 
  | getPrevElectricField() | OpenMD::StuntDouble | inline | 
  | getPrevEuler() | OpenMD::StuntDouble | inline | 
  | getPrevFlucQFrc() | OpenMD::StuntDouble | inline | 
  | getPrevFlucQPos() | OpenMD::StuntDouble | inline | 
  | getPrevFlucQVel() | OpenMD::StuntDouble | inline | 
  | getPrevFrc() | OpenMD::StuntDouble | inline | 
  | getPrevJ() | OpenMD::StuntDouble | inline | 
  | getPrevParticlePot() | OpenMD::StuntDouble | inline | 
  | getPrevPos() | OpenMD::StuntDouble | inline | 
  | getPrevQ() | OpenMD::StuntDouble | inline | 
  | getPrevQuadrupole() | OpenMD::StuntDouble | inline | 
  | getPrevSitePotential() | OpenMD::StuntDouble | inline | 
  | getPrevTrq() | OpenMD::StuntDouble | inline | 
  | getPrevVel() | OpenMD::StuntDouble | inline | 
  | getProperties() | OpenMD::StuntDouble |  | 
  | getPropertyByName(const std::string &propName) | OpenMD::StuntDouble |  | 
  | getPropertyNames() | OpenMD::StuntDouble |  | 
  | getQ() | OpenMD::StuntDouble | inline | 
  | getQ(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getQuadrupole() | OpenMD::StuntDouble | inline | 
  | getQuadrupole(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getSitePotential() | OpenMD::StuntDouble | inline | 
  | getSitePotential(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getTrq() | OpenMD::StuntDouble | inline | 
  | getTrq(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getType() | OpenMD::Atom | inlinevirtual | 
  | getType() | OpenMD::Atom | inlinevirtual | 
  | getVel() | OpenMD::StuntDouble | inline | 
  | getVel(int snapshotNo) | OpenMD::StuntDouble | inline | 
  | getVel(Snapshot *snapshot)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| inline | 
  | globalIndex_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| globalIntegrableObjectIndex_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| hyb_ (defined in OpenMD::Atom) | OpenMD::Atom | protected | 
  | isAtom() | OpenMD::StuntDouble | inline | 
  | isCharge()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isCharge()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isDipole()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isDipole()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isDirectional()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isDirectional()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isDirectionalAtom() | OpenMD::StuntDouble | inline | 
  | isFluctuatingCharge()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isFluctuatingCharge()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isGayBerne()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isGayBerne()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isLinear() | OpenMD::StuntDouble | inline | 
  | isMetal()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isMetal()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isMultipole()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isMultipole()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isRigidBody() | OpenMD::StuntDouble | inline | 
  | isShape()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isShape()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isSticky()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| isSticky() (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| lab2Body(const Vector3d &v) | OpenMD::StuntDouble | inline | 
  | lab2Body(const Vector3d &v, int frame)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| inline | 
  | linear_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| linearAxis() | OpenMD::StuntDouble | inline | 
  | linearAxis_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| localIndex_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| mass_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| ObjectType enum name (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ble |  | 
  | objType_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| operator=(const StuntDouble &sd)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| otAtom enum value (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ble |  | 
  | otDAtom enum value (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ble |  | 
  | otRigidBody enum value (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ble |  | 
  | removeProperty(const std::string &propName) | OpenMD::StuntDouble |  | 
  | setA(const RotMat3x3d &a) | OpenMD::StuntDouble | inlinevirtual | 
  | setA(const RotMat3x3d &a, int snapshotNo) | OpenMD::StuntDouble | inlinevirtual | 
  | setChargeMass(RealType cm) (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| setChargeMass(RealType cm) (defined in OpenMD::Atom) | OpenMD::Atom | inline | 
  | setDensity(RealType dens) | OpenMD::StuntDouble | inline | 
  | setDensity(RealType dens,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setElectricField(const Vector3d &eField) | OpenMD::StuntDouble | inline | 
  | setElectricField(const Vector3d &eField,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setEuler(const Vector3d &euler) | OpenMD::StuntDouble | inline | 
  | setEuler(const Vector3d &euler,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setFlucQFrc(RealType cfrc) | OpenMD::StuntDouble | inline | 
  | setFlucQFrc(RealType cfrc,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setFlucQPos(RealType charge) | OpenMD::StuntDouble | inline | 
  | setFlucQPos(RealType charge,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setFlucQVel(RealType cvel) | OpenMD::StuntDouble | inline | 
  | setFlucQVel(RealType cvel,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setFrc(const Vector3d &frc) | OpenMD::StuntDouble | inline | 
  | setFrc(const Vector3d &frc,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setGlobalIndex(int index) | OpenMD::StuntDouble | inline | 
  | setGlobalIntegrableObjectIndex(int index)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| inline | 
  | setHybridization(HybridizationType what) | OpenMD::Atom | inline | 
  | setJ(const Vector3d &angMom) | OpenMD::StuntDouble | inline | 
  | setJ(const Vector3d &angMom,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setLocalIndex(int index) | OpenMD::StuntDouble | inline | 
  | setMass(RealType mass) | OpenMD::StuntDouble | inline | 
  | setParticlePot(const RealType &particlePot) | OpenMD::StuntDouble | inline | 
  | setParticlePot(const RealType &particlePot,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setPos(const Vector3d &pos) | OpenMD::StuntDouble | inline | 
  | setPos(const Vector3d &pos,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setPrevA(const RotMat3x3d &a) | OpenMD::StuntDouble | inlinevirtual | 
  | setPrevDensity(RealType dens) | OpenMD::StuntDouble | inline | 
  | setPrevElectricField(const Vector3d &eField) | OpenMD::StuntDouble | inline | 
  | setPrevEuler(const Vector3d &euler) | OpenMD::StuntDouble | inline | 
  | setPrevFlucQFrc(RealType cfrc) | OpenMD::StuntDouble | inline | 
  | setPrevFlucQPos(RealType charge) | OpenMD::StuntDouble | inline | 
  | setPrevFlucQVel(RealType cvel) | OpenMD::StuntDouble | inline | 
  | setPrevFrc(const Vector3d &frc) | OpenMD::StuntDouble | inline | 
  | setPrevJ(const Vector3d &angMom) | OpenMD::StuntDouble | inline | 
  | setPrevParticlePot(const RealType &particlePot) | OpenMD::StuntDouble | inline | 
  | setPrevPos(const Vector3d &pos) | OpenMD::StuntDouble | inline | 
  | setPrevQ(const Quat4d &q) | OpenMD::StuntDouble | inline | 
  | setPrevSitePotential(RealType spot) | OpenMD::StuntDouble | inline | 
  | setPrevTrq(const Vector3d &trq) | OpenMD::StuntDouble | inline | 
  | setPrevVel(const Vector3d &vel) | OpenMD::StuntDouble | inline | 
  | setQ(const Quat4d &q) | OpenMD::StuntDouble | inline | 
  | setQ(const Quat4d &q,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setSitePotential(RealType spot) | OpenMD::StuntDouble | inline | 
  | setSitePotential(RealType spot,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setSnapshotManager(SnapshotManager *sman) | OpenMD::StuntDouble | inline | 
  | setTrq(const Vector3d &trq) | OpenMD::StuntDouble | inline | 
  | setTrq(const Vector3d &trq,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| setType(const std::string &) | OpenMD::StuntDouble | inlinevirtual | 
  | setVel(const Vector3d &vel) | OpenMD::StuntDouble | inline | 
  | setVel(const Vector3d &vel, int snapshotNo) | OpenMD::StuntDouble | inline | 
  | snapshotMan_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| storage_ (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| StuntDouble(ObjectType objType, DataStoragePointer storage)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| StuntDouble(const StuntDouble &sd) (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| protected | 
  | zeroForcesAndTorques() | OpenMD::StuntDouble |  | 
  | ~StuntDouble()=default (defined in OpenMD::StuntDouble) | OpenMD::StuntDouble | virtual |